¿Cómo hacer que arranque por defecto Windows en lugar de Ubuntu? (Solucionado)

Imagen de komikieee
0 puntos

He copiado y pegado la pregunta que aparece en las FAQs ya que a mi no me funciona lo que dice ahi, es decir, si escribo

sudo gedit /boot/grub/menu.lst

Se abre el editor de textos gedit pero ¡¡en BLANCO!! es decir ¡¡no hay texto!!

Imagen de hellboy
+1
0
-1

Que versión de ubuntu usas para saber la versión de grub que estas usando.

http://iloo.wordpress.com

+1
0
-1

---------------------------------
| http://iloo.wordpress.com |
---------------------------------

Imagen de komikieee
+1
0
-1

9.10

+1
0
-1
Imagen de billycomadreja
+1
0
-1

Como primera medida debes abrir el terminal de comandos y hacer copia de seguridad del archivo grub.cfg de la siguiente manera
cp /boot/grub/grub.cfg /boot/grub/grub_bkp.cfg
hecho esto vas a editar dicho archivo de configuración mencionado (gurb.cfg) de la siguiente forma:
sudo gedit /boot/grub/grub.cfg
te pedirá tu password de administrador (es el que pusiste cuando lo instalaste Ubuntu)
Una vez dentro del archivo iras solo a la linea que dice:
set default="0" y remplazaras el "0" por un "4" y listo. Guardas con control+O y cerras con control+X, reinicias la maquina y veras que está todo como querías, marca por defecto el Windows.
La explicación es sencilla, a ti te aparece un listado en el boteeo del Grub, por lo cual linux empieza a contar esa lista desde el "0" para iniciar Ubuntu,"1", el siguiente y así hasta el "4" que es el Windows por eso si cuentas veras cinco lineas, pero como arranca de cero es el valor "4" a poner. Espero haberme explicado bien y por favor informa aquí si has solucionado tu probblema.
BillyComadreja®

+1
0
-1

BillyComadreja®

Imagen de komikieee
+1
0
-1

Gracias BillyComadreja por tu respuesta, justo en este momento estaba probando lo que me decia otro forero al final del tema este y la verdad que he borrado las lineas usando el synaptic y he usado el StartUp Manager para cambiar el SO de inicio.

+1
0
-1
Imagen de hellboy
+1
0
-1

Bueno el tema es que en la versión 9.10 de ubuntu se usa el grub 2, ya no existe el archivo menu.lst, lee un poco para que versión son los pasos que te indican en algunos tutos ya que puedes dejar tu sistema inoperable, en todo caso aquí va la respuesta:

primero habre como superusuario el siguiente archivo, bueno te lo dejo fácil esto en consola:

sudo gedit /boot/grub/grub.cfg

busca la línea:

set default="0"

Ahora si en grub te carga algo como esto:

Ubuntu, Linux 2.6.31-14-generic
Ubuntu, Linux 2.6.31-14-generic (recovery mode)
Memory test (memtest86+)
Memory test (memtest86+, serial console 115200)
Windows 7 (loader) (on /dev/sda1)

Entonces tienes que enumerar desde el 0.

0 / Ubuntu, Linux 2.6.31-14-generic
1 / Ubuntu, Linux 2.6.31-14-generic (recovery mode)
2 / Memory test (memtest86+)
3 / Memory test (memtest86+, serial console 115200)
4 / Windows 7 (loader) (on /dev/sda1)

Entonces en el archivo de configuración pones:

set default="4"

Guardas los cambios y listo.

http://iloo.wordpress.com

+1
0
-1

---------------------------------
| http://iloo.wordpress.com |
---------------------------------

Imagen de komikieee
+1
0
-1

Gracias Hellboy por la solucion pero no me sirve...

Llego a abrir el documento usando el comando que me das para la terminal pero una vez modificado el texto no me deja guardarlo ya que:

No se puede guardar el archivo /boot/grub/grub.cfg.
Esta intentando guardar el archivo en un disco de solo lectura.
Compruebe que ha escrito el lugar correctamente y pruebe de nuevo.

Y sobre lo demas y adelantantome tengo una pregunta.En mi PC cuando instale el Ubuntu 9.10 por primera vez si que tenia el grub de ese modo, es decir:

Ubuntu, Linux 2.6.31-14-generic
Ubuntu, Linux 2.6.31-14-generic (recovery mode)
Memory test (memtest86+)
Memory test (memtest86+, serial console 115200)
Windows XP (loader) (on /dev/sda1)

Pero ahora y despues de actualizaciones lo tengo asi:

Ubuntu, Linux 2.6.31-17-generic
Ubuntu, Linux 2.6.31-17-generic (recovery mode)
Ubuntu, Linux 2.6.31-16-generic
Ubuntu, Linux 2.6.31-16-generic (recovery mode)
Ubuntu, Linux 2.6.31-15-generic
Ubuntu, Linux 2.6.31-15-generic (recovery mode)
Ubuntu, Linux 2.6.31-14-generic
Ubuntu, Linux 2.6.31-14-generic (recovery mode)
Memory test (memtest86+)
Memory test (memtest86+, serial console 115200)
Windows XP (loader) (on /dev/sda1)

Siguiendo lo que me dices en tu mensaje entiendo que tendria que enumerar como 10 ¿verdad? Pero ¿que pasa cuando se actualice el Grub y haya mas lineas?

Gracias de nuevo.

Entonces tienes que enumerar desde el 0.

0 / Ubuntu, Linux 2.6.31-14-generic
1 / Ubuntu, Linux 2.6.31-14-generic (recovery mode)
2 / Memory test (memtest86+)
3 / Memory test (memtest86+, serial console 115200)
4 / Windows 7 (loader) (on /dev/sda1)

Entonces en el archivo de configuración pones:

+1
0
-1
Imagen de Ignaci0
+1
0
-1

Siguiendo lo que me dices en tu mensaje entiendo que tendria que enumerar como 10 ¿verdad? Pero ¿que pasa cuando se actualice el Grub y haya mas lineas?

Dos cosas te puedo indicar: la primera es que cuando actualizas los programas se SUSTITUYEN los antiguos por los nuevos, excepto cuando se actualizan los linux-image. Los antiguos linux-image se dejan por si hay problemas y tienes que arrancar con uno anterior. Pero si ves que te funcionan bien, no hay por qué mantenerlos todos, o sea que podrías desinstalar los más antiguos y dejar solo dos, por ej. Liberas espacio y aligeras la lista de grub...

En segundo lugar, se recomienda encarecidamente NO editar el archivo grub.cnf, no está pensado para eso.

Las modificaciones al grub se hacen en /etc/grub.d/... o en /etc/default/grub
Para lo que quieres, ése último es el adecuado:

sudo gedit /etc/default/grub

En la primera entrada
GRUB_DEFAULT=0
sustituye 0 por el número de entrada de win2
pero te tienes que acordar de cambiar esto cada vez que se actualice el núcleo, por lo que otra opción es

sustituye el 0 por el título que aparece en tu lista de grub, por ejemplo
"Windows XP Professional (on /dev/sda1)"
Asegúrate de poner el título de la lista que hay en tu grub.cnf, lo anterior es un ejemplo. (Más opciones y explicaciones en https://wiki.ubuntu.com/Grub2 --en inglés--)
En todo caso, después de hacer las modificaciones, debes ejecutar

sudo update-grub

para actualizar los cambis en grub.cnf
Suerte
PD: Arrancar güin2 por omisión (defecto) es "ansia viva"? xD PINgüin0»güin2 ;)

+1
0
-1
Imagen de komikieee
+1
0
-1

Pero si ves que te funcionan bien, no hay por qué mantenerlos todos, o sea que podrías desinstalar los más antiguos y dejar solo dos, por ej. Liberas espacio y aligeras la lista de grub...

Gracias Ignaci0 ¿como borro las lineas del grub que no me interesan? Despues de desinstalar esas lineas ya probare lo que me comentas.

+1
0
-1
Imagen de Ignaci0
+1
0
-1

Desinstalando los paquetes linux-image antiguos, por ejemplo en Sistema>Asministracion> Gestor synaptic
se actualiza automáticamente la lista del grub y ya no aparecerán en ella.

+1
0
-1
Imagen de komikieee
+1
0
-1

¿Y como busco en el Synaptic las lineas que deseo borrar sin peligro a borrar algo importante?

+1
0
-1
Imagen de jedam2000
+1
0
-1

Hola komikieee.

con la ayuda de esta guía (ver link al final) pude configurar el grub2 a mi gusto, creo que a ti también te podrá dar respuesta a muchas de las preguntas que tienes de como maquetearlo. además tambien explican como configurar el antiguo grub
http://www.guia-ubuntu.org/index.php?title=GRUB#Modificaciones_en_el_men...

+1
0
-1
Imagen de komikieee
+1
0
-1

Gracias amigo pero de momento la informacion que contiene ese link me parece muy complicada y delicada de usar.

+1
0
-1
Imagen de Manolo_ultimate
+1
0
-1

Bueno yo uso Ubuntu 8.10,pero supongo que en Karmic también debe estar la aplicación llamada Startup Manager; así que checa este enlace de la Guía Ubuntu. Yo edito el menú "manualmente" pero como en Karmic cambio el grub pues te lo recomiendo. Espero que te sea de ayuda saludos!!

------------------------------------------------------------------------------------------------------------------------------------
Aprendiendo cada día un poco más de GNU/Linux =)

+1
0
-1

Aprendiendo cada día un poco más de GNU/Linux =)

Imagen de komikieee
+1
0
-1

Gracias Manolo_ultimate, el Startup Manager me ha venido muy bien para poder elegir con que sistema operativo arrancar. Lo que no he podido hacer es borrar las lineas de kernel que sobran...

+1
0
-1
Imagen de Ignaci0
+1
0
-1

Sistema > Admón > Gestor de paquetes Synaptic
Pulsa en el panel lateral en la parte de abajo el botón EStado y luego arriba en Instalados
Te saldrán todos los paquetes instalados en tu sistema.
Haz clic sobre cualquier programa a la derecha, y desliza la lista (o escribe en el teclado linux-image) hasta que veas "linux-image-2.6.31-14-generic"
Según un mensaje tuyo anterior tienes el 14, el 15, el 16 y el 17
Pue bien puedes desinstalar tranquilamente los dos más antiguos (14, 15) pulsando con el derecho del raton y eligiendo desinstalar completamente. Tu sistema siempre funciona con la versión de linux-image más reciente por lo que las antiguas están de más. Y además, si no notas fallos podrías incluso desinstalar la 16, aunque se suele dejar la penúltima versión por si hay fallos en el último kernel.
Si tienes instalados los linux-headers, desinstala tambiién los que correspondan a las linux-image que desinstales.
Pulsa Aplicar (arriba).
El listado del grub se actualiza automáticamente y desaparecen las líneas de las images desintaladas
Salu2

+1
0
-1
Imagen de komikieee
+1
0
-1

Gracias Ignacio0, ya esta todo perfecto (al menos en este tema) :-)

+1
0
-1
Imagen de billycomadreja
+1
0
-1

Cuando no funciona el comando gedit, sugiero luego de hacer el primer paso antes citados de copia de respaldo del archivo:
sudo pico /boot/grub/grub.cfg
va a pedir la contraseña que pusiste cuando instalaste el Ubuntu 9.10
luego haces las modificaciones descriptas antes para gedit y guardas con control+O (es la letra, no un cero) y salís del programa con control+X. Cerras la consola tecleando exit y reinicias la máquina. Espero te sirva.

+1
0
-1

BillyComadreja®

Imagen de erpajaro
+1
0
-1

Hola a todos.

Mi duda es, poner ubuntu por defecto desde winwdows, se que en panel de control deberia poderse, pero solo me da la opcion de windows, y le doy a editar, en el cual sale el boot tipico de windows pero nada del grub, existe alguna aplicacion como startup para windows??? (no lo puedo hacer manualmente en el grub ya que tengo un teclado inalambrico que no responde alli).

Saludos.

+1
0
-1
Imagen de Alexj83
+1
0
-1

Gracias BillyComadreja y a hellboy, sus respuesta me ayudaron con mi problema, soy nuevo utilizando Linux, por lo cual, aun mantengo instalado Windows 7 ya que la familia está acostumbrada al uso de éste, y me replicaban cada ves que prenden la PC e inicia Ubunto, gracias a sus respuesta este problema ya lo solucione, saludos desde Venezuela uso actualmente Ubunto 11.04.

+1
0
-1